Mary "Joyce" Repinski (or Joyce to those who knew her because of so many "Mary's" in the family) was born in, Oak Park, IL, on November 11, 1958, to the late Dana and Mary (Adkins) McCormick. She left this world to join the Lord and the angels on Sunday, June 22, 2025. Joyce had four siblings, Dana McCormick, Blanche Bonnell, Pinkie Wood, and Audie McCormick. She married her one true love, Frank Repinski, on August 7, 1976; the best day of her life as she would say. She had three amazing children, her favorite son, John; her favorite daughters (who varied on who was the favorite) Beth and Mary; and her five wonderful grandchildren.

Joyce considered friends family. She loved her family above all else. She had visitors at her home at all hours of the day and because of this, her home was dubbed "Grand Central Station". She loved hosting famous family gatherings and the meals and love that came with them. Joyce lived a life of service to all around her. She lived to help others. Her many acts of kindness gave her a purpose in life. Joyce was a second mother and nana to so many nieces, nephews, and grandchildren which made her heart shine. She loved traveling, especially with her sisters, and going to Florida. Joyce was fortunate to visit places all around the world. She was so loved and will truly be missed by all. Although we are all mourning, she would prefer that we celebrate her life and remember the happy times and memories together.

Survivors include her husband of over 48 years, Frank Repinski; her son, John (Rhonda) Repinski; her daughters, Beth (Fred) Staub, and Mary Repinski; her grandchildren, Tyler, David, Taylor, Alexis, and Elias; and her siblings, Blanche Bonnell, Pinkie (Dexter) Wood, and Audie (Joyce) McCormick. She is further survived by many nieces, nephews, and cousins. Joyce was preceded in death by her parents, Dana and Mary; her brother, Dana McCormick; and her brother-in-law, Bill Bonnell.

Memorial services for Mary Joyce Repinski will be held on Saturday, June 28, 2025, at 11:00 AM, at Redeemer Evangelical Lutheran Church. Pastor Mark Gass will officiate. The family will receive friends for visitation from 9:00 AM until the time of services at 11:00 AM. Inurnment will follow at the Greenwood Cemetery. Memorials are appreciated to any local charity of your choice in Joyce's name. Generations Funeral Home & Crematory is assisting the family.
